Cracked Pipings


Pressure from the environments can create sewage system line pipes to fracture. Tree roots can twist around drain lines and damage and even crack the pipelines resulting in leak. Drain lines in older homes are a lot more susceptible to this kind of damages.

Corroded Pipeline


Calcium and also magnesium develop with time can make sewage pipelines rust. If left unattended to can trigger splits and leakages in the lengthy run, the corrosion.

Blocked pipelines


The sewer system can not deal with content that will not conveniently deteriorate. Flushing things Iike nylon and also paper towels away over time can cause your sewer line being obstructed. Oil and grease can additionally obstruct your sewer line which is why they ought to be thrown out in a container rather than down the tubes.

Sewage System Line Repair or Replacement


Relying on the extent of damages your sewage system line might need repair services or substitute of some parts that are not acting up to the same level. A sewage system line assessment need to be done with a drain cam to establish the extent of the damage. For minor damages, pipeline lining is an outstanding repair service alternative; cost-effective and non-time consuming. Trenchless sewage system line fixing is also a choice. For even more significant problems, the traditional method of digging as well as excavation may be required to alter the whole sewer line. This is an invasive method that is both time-consuming as well as expensive. To avoid drain line damages from happening as well as dragging in enough time before being discovered, have drain line assessments performed yearly as well as guarantee that only products that will weaken are purged down the drain. Correct use your sewage system will expand its life expectancy. Remove trees that are creating damage or most likely to trigger damages to your drain line from the premises.

How Do You Replace a Sewer Line?


Sewage backup




If sewage backs up every time, or almost every time, you flush the toilet, the problem could be your main sewer line. All your home’s drains rely on the main sewer line so if more than one toiler is having a problem, then it is probably your main sewer drain.


Sewage Smells




An intact main sewer line should be airtight, meaning no odors should escape the pipes. If you start to smell something foul, however, that could mean a leak in the main sewer line. If the scent of rotten eggs and sewage starts leaking out of your drains, it’s time to call a plumber.


Mold.


One small crack in a water or sewer line can cause enough water to leak into your home, resulting in mold growth. Because mold is very harmful to your health, contact a plumber is you notice mold on the walls or ceilings.

Extra Full patches of grass.


Your lawn may be looking extra lush than usual, because sewage acts as a fertilizer, so if you have patches of very green grass, it could be from a leaking sewer line.


Cracks in the Foundation.


A damaged main sewer line can cause structural damage to your home. Broken sewer lines left untreated over time can lead to cracks in your home’s foundation or sinkholes.
